1. SCOPE OF EXTENDED PROJECT MANAGEMENT CONSULTING SERVICES

Bechtel will provide the additional project management consulting services for an additional period in accordance with the basic scope description of Amendment No. 1, and will provide project staff in numbers and classifications and for such durations and at such locations as are specified in this amendment.



A. General Project Management and Administration

Extending beyond the duration of staffing provided for under Amendment No. 1, Bechtel shall continue to provide extended project management consultation to assist the owner in management activities on the project. Full-time, on-site project management staff will be provided by Bechtel to fill positions in the University's project management organization as agents of the University. This staffing shall include a project manager who will report to and receive direction from the University's project director, and will provide direction to other subordinate positions in the project management organization engaged directly by the University. Additional off-site support shall be furnished to the on-site staff from the Bechtel home office.

All other provisions of the original agreement and Amendment No. 1 relating to the provision of these project management consulting services shall remain unchanged.

B. Special Project Management Consulting Services

In addition to the extended general project management and administration consulting services described above, Bechtel will continue to provide other special project management consulting services or assistance when required by the University under separately and additionally compensated effort. These additional special services will be provided only upon specific prior written authorization by the University as provided in Amendment No. 1.
